Sessional kindergarten operates during school terms with set hours for each session. In the City of Casey, sessional kindergarten is run by both Council and external providers.
Families will be able to register their child for kindergarten in the year before their child turns 3.
Children must be 3 years old before they can start kindergarten. Children born between January and April can start:
- 3-year-old kindergarten in the year they turn 3 or 4
- 4-year-old kindergarten in the year they turn 4 or 5
Families need to decide the year their child will begin kindergarten. Use the kindergarten age calculator to help you decide.
Important Note:
- Kindergarten is not compulsory
- Children do not need to be an Australian citizen to attend.
